About This Item

(Chicago, IL): Bowman Publishing Co., 1907. Published by the Class of 1907 420 pages + 24 pages of ads. Including 1 color engraving of "The Kimona Girl" by Barnes-Crosby Co. Black cloth w/ gilt titles and top edge. pos ffep (Hedwig Bremmeneau ?). Covers stained and edge worn. Hinges are cracked. 1½" edge tear to page 173. ½" stain to page edges. Interior pages mostly crisp/clean with no autographs observed - interior a nice VG.. Cloth. Fair. 4to - over 9¾" - 12" tall.
